The point where the concentration on both sides of a membrane is equal to each other is called the<u> Isotonic Point.
</u>
Explanation:
The result is that osmosis cannot or stops to occur. For net water movement to occur, the solution on one side of the membrane needs to have a higher concentration than the other.
isotonicity can also occur between two membranes when due to the process of Osmosis, the concentration on both sides of of the membrane have equalised.

Hormones can be proteins, lipids or cholesterol-based molecules. Neurotransmitters are protein. The main difference between hormones and neurotransmitters is that Hormones are produced in the endocrine glands and released into the bloodstream where they find their movement targets at a distance from their origin. In contrast, Neurotransmitters are released into the synaptic space by a terminal of an excited presynaptic nerve cell and transmit a nerve signal to the neighboring postsynaptic nerve cell.
